What does this PR do?
This PR adds rel="noopener noreferrer" to the Datadog link in the blocking HTML template.

Motivation:
A customer is reporting that their vulnerability scanner is flagging the default ASM WAF blocking page for a security issue.

Change log entry
Yes. Make AppSec blocking page more friendly to vulnerability scanners.
